Vue是一種流行的前端JavaScript框架,可用于開發響應式的網站。但是,Vue實際上也可以用于開發移動應用程序,即Vue觸手可及(Vue Native)。
Vue Native是一個基于React Native開發的框架,可以幫助開發人員使用Vue語法編寫原生移動應用程序。Vue Native是 Vue.js 的移動應用開發解決方案,它借鑒了 React Native的設計思路,使用 Vue.js 語法來構建移動應用。
Vue Native將Vue的組件模型與原生移動應用程序中的組件模型進行了整合。這意味著您可以使用Vue組件來創建可在移動設備上明顯優化且相當快的本機應用程序。
Vue Native使用相同的Node.js和NPM依賴關系,可幫助開發人員構建真正的跨平臺移動應用程序,而無需使用編寫本機應用程序的完全不同的語言。
Vue Native與Vue.js相似,遵循類似的生命周期和選項,使開發移動應用程序變得更加容易。
為了使用Vue Native構建移動應用程序,您需要以下東西:
1. Node.js和NPM。
2. 代碼編輯器,例如VS Code。
3. Vue CLI。
Vue CLI是一個命令行界面,可幫助您輕松創建和配置Vue項目。您可以使用Vue CLI通過運行示例應用程序來了解Vue Native。
Vue Native使用React Native的UI庫,這意味著您可以使用React Native組件和API來操作設備硬件。此外,Vue Native還提供了對Vue普通組件的全面支持,您可以在應用程序中使用它們。
最后,Vue Native通過在本地渲染Vue.js的Vue組件來構建UI,這使得移動應用程序幾乎與原生應用程序一樣快速,同時也讓您使用Vue語法來編寫。
總之,Vue可以用于開發移動應用程序,您只需使用Vue Native進行使用。Vue Native為開發人員提供了編寫使用Vue語法構建的原生移動應用程序的基礎和工具,這大大簡化了開發的過程,并確保您獲得最佳的性能和用戶體驗。